WebJul 13, 2024 · According to the Department of Health and Human Services' Office of Minority Health, 13.4% of Black men and 12.7% of Black women have been diagnosed with diabetes. Combined, their rate is 60% higher than that of white people. In the U.S., Black people are twice as likely as their white counterparts to die of diabetes. You can also use the US Diabetes Surveillance System, an interactive web tool … The most common type of diabetes is type 2 diabetes, making up 90.9% of all diabetes cases [4]. 5.8% have type 1 diabetes. It’s the second most common type of diabetes [4]. Other types of diabetes make up 3.3% of all diabetes cases. These include gestational diabetes and neonatal diabetes [4].
